W Central Texas EXPW Collision Results in Injury
Killeen, TX (May 8, 2024) – 49-year-old Michael Ray Meredith was arrested following a W Central Texas Expressway DUI crash late Saturday night.
KPD officers responded at about 10:53 p.m. to the collision near Santa Rosa Drive. They said Meredith was driving an eastbound Ford Focus in westbound lanes when his vehicle crashed into a Kia Sportage.
The Kia driver incurred injuries from the collision and was transported to an area hospital.
When the authorities spoke with Meredith, they noticed that his speech was heavily slurred. Officers arrested him following field sobriety tests.
Meredith was charged with DWI with a blood alcohol level greater than .15 and aggravated assault with a deadly weapon. He was booked at the Bell County Jail Tuesday with his bond set at a total of $82,500.

Just one drink before driving can put you and others in danger because alcohol impairs thinking, reasoning, and muscle coordination. Impaired driving poses a serious threat to road safety. It increases the risk of accidents, injuries, and fatalities. Alcohol and drugs impair judgment, reaction time, and coordination, making it difficult for drivers to safely operate a vehicle.
By choosing not to drink and drive, you are taking an important step towards protecting yourself and others on the road.
